Jo Jakeman winner of the prestigious Friday Night Live competition at York Festival of Writing. Jo is a novelist living in Derby with her family.
After several failed attempts to get an agent, she embarked on a writing course with Curtis Brown Creative in 2016. That same year she won Friday Night Live at the York Festival of Writing by reading the opening chapter of the book that was to become her debut thriller, Sticks and Stones.
Jo’s latest novel, Safe House was released in October 2019.
